The average a&p mechanic gross salary in Modena, Italy is 36.249 € or an equivalent hourly rate of 17 €. This is 1% higher (+292 €) than the average a&p mechanic salary in Italy. In addition, they earn an average bonus of 1.145 €. Salary estimates based on salary survey data collected directly from employers and anonymous employees in Modena, Italy. An entry level a&p mechanic (1-3 years of experience) earns an average salary of 26.565 €. On the other end, a senior level a&p mechanic (8+ years of experience) earns an average salary of 44.251 €.

Modena (UK: , US: , Italian: [ˈmɔːdena] ; Modenese: Mòdna [ˈmɔdnɐ]; Etruscan: Mutna; Latin: Mutina) is a city and comune (municipality) on the south side of the Po Valley, in the Province of Modena, in the Emilia-Romagna region of northern Italy. A town, and seat of an archbishop, it is known for its car industry since the factories of the famous Italian upper-class sports car makers Ferrari, De Tomaso, Lamborghini, Pagani and Maserati are, or were, located there and all, except Lamborghini, have...

Services, repairs, and overhauls various aircraft components and systems including airframes, engines, electrical and hydraulic systems, propellers, avionics equipment, and aircraft instruments. Performs either line maintenance work, including routine maintenance, servicing, or emergency repairs at airline terminals, or major repairs and periodic inspections at an airline's overhaul base.
